Step 1: Identify Your Project Requirements

  • Assess the type of work you need to accomplish.
  • Determine the terrain where the machinery will be used.

For projects involving rough or uneven terrain, a track loader might be more suitable due to its superior traction and stability. On the other hand, for flat, solid surfaces, a wheel loader typically offers faster movement and maneuverability.

Step 2: Compare Power and Performance

  • Evaluate engine power and lifting capabilities.
  • Consider the operational speed required for your tasks.

Track loaders generally have higher torque, making them effective for heavy-duty jobs like grading or excavation, especially in challenging conditions. Wheel loaders, however, excel in speed and can move materials quickly across flat surfaces, ideal for loading and transporting bulk materials.

Step 3: Analyze Operating Costs

  • Calculate fuel efficiency and maintenance needs.
  • Review the resale values of both loader types.

In many cases, track loaders might incur higher maintenance costs due to their complex undercarriage systems. However, if your project requires extensive use over difficult terrain, the operational efficiency may justify the costs. Conversely, wheel loaders may offer lower operating costs but may lack the rugged capability needed in certain scenarios.

Step 4: Consider Operator Comfort and Safety

  • Review ergonomic features and cabin design.
  • Investigate safety systems built into each loader type.

Modern wheel loaders often come equipped with advanced comfort features and visibility enhancements, allowing operators to work longer hours with less fatigue. Track loaders also have quality cabins but may prioritize robustness over luxury, appealing to those who need durability over comfort in harsh environments.

Step 5: Look at Attachments and Versatility

  • Identify the types of attachments required for your tasks.
  • Check compatibility with existing equipment.

Both track loaders and wheel loaders offer a variety of attachments, such as buckets, forks, and hydraulic tools. However, if your projects demand diverse operations, wheel loaders might offer more flexibility due to a broader range of available attachments, making them suitable for multiple tasks.

Step 6: Analyze the Total Cost of Ownership

  • Factor in purchase price, depreciation, and maintenance over time.
  • Consider financing options and warranties.

Investing in either a track loader or a wheel loader involves more than just the initial purchase. Understanding the total cost of ownership can significantly influence your decision. While track loaders may cost more upfront, their durability in tough conditions could mean less frequent replacements, thus balancing out costs in the long run.
